Chipping Norton 2nd closed the gap on OCA League Division 8 leaders Ducklington with a three-wicket win at Chesterton 2nd.
Mark Jarvis took 4-32 to reduce Chesterton to 118.
Chippy lost regular wickets in their reply, but edged home at 119-7.
In Division 9, Witney Swifts 2nd’s victory charge ended in the rain at home to Britwell Salome 2nd.
They had scored 203-6, Derek Craig hitting 58, before reducing the visitors to 122-5.
Minster Lovell 3rd edged a thriller at Dorchester 2nd by two runs.
Dan Spencer (38) and Russell Whitlock (30) led Minster to 182-9, John Pitson taking 6-55.
Mike Ottrey hit 70 in Dorchester’s reply, but they closed just short on 180-5.
In Division 10, Kilkenny’s Kashif Hafeez took 5-15 to help them win by eight wickets at Hanney 2nd.
Hanney were bowled out for 71, before Kilkenny eased to 77-2.
